摘要 Embodiments of the present disclosure provide a touch display panel and a touch display apparatus, which can reduce a width of a bezel of the touch display apparatus and meet a requirement for a narrow bezel of the touch display apparatus. The touch display panel comprises: a plurality of first electrode lines disposed in a first direction; a FPC located above or below a display area; and first electrode wirings each electrically connected to the respective first electrode line correspondingly, wherein each of the first electrode wirings is led from a side of the display area which is close to the FPC and is electrically connected to the FPC. In this solution according to the embodiment of the present disclosure, each of the first electrode wirings is directly led from the side of the display area which is close to the FPC and would not occupy a width of a bezel; therefore the bezel of the touch display apparatus can be designed as narrower, which greatly meets the requirement for the narrow bezel of the touch display apparatus.

主权项 1. A touch display panel, comprising: a first substrate comprising a plate-type common electrode layer, wherein the plate-type common electrode layer comprises a plurality of first electrode lines disposed in a first direction; a Flexible Printed Circuit (FPC) board located above or below a display area; and first electrode wirings each electrically connected to each of the first electrode lines respectively, wherein each of the first electrode wirings is led from a side of the display area which is close to the FPC board and is electrically connected to the FPC board; wherein the first substrate further comprises a plurality of data lines disposed in a second direction intersected with the first direction; and the first electrode wirings are disposed in a same layer as the plurality of data lines and are parallel to the plurality of data lines, and each of the first electrode wirings is electrically connected to each of the plurality of first electrode lines respectively via a via-hole structure in a first insulation layer.
